Exhaust Issues and Leaks

One of the main culprits behind sputtering could be a problem with the exhaust system. Specifically, a cracked exhaust manifold can let out harmful gases that should normally flow through the system. These gases could even melt plastic components and damage seals and gaskets nearby. As a result, you might notice a poor performance, extra noise, and potentially even dangerous driving conditions. If the manifold is leaking, it may also let harmful fumes into the cabin, which makes fixing it an urgent matter.

Faulty Catalytic Converter

Another reason for your Infiniti Q56 sputtering might be related to the catalytic converter. This part helps reduce sulfur-based emissions and burns hydrocarbons. However, when it becomes blocked or malfunctions, your vehicle could start to emit a rotten egg smell. This could trigger the Check Engine light, and the engine might begin running either rich or lean, causing the sputtering that you’ve noticed during acceleration. It’s essential to have this part checked if you suspect it’s causing your issues.

Oxygen Sensors and Fuel Mixture

The oxygen sensors play a critical role in monitoring the air-fuel ratio in the engine. If they fail, it can lead to improper fuel mixing, causing the engine to sputter or struggle during acceleration. Uneven combustion could also be a result of these sensor issues, leading to a noticeable loss of power. The engine computer may have difficulty adjusting the fuel mixture, which can make your car run rough. To avoid further damage, these sensors should be inspected regularly and replaced as needed.

Fuel Injector Blockages

Fuel injectors spray fuel into the engine’s cylinders, so if they’re clogged with dirt or other contaminants, the fuel won’t be properly mixed with air. This can cause misfires, rough acceleration, and, of course, sputtering. If you’ve been noticing a loss of power when stepping on the gas, it could very well be because the fuel injectors need to be cleaned. Regular maintenance can prevent this issue from getting worse over time.

Fuel-Related other Problems

Sometimes the issue may be as simple as running low on gas or having a faulty fuel gauge that doesn’t display the correct level. Additionally, if your fuel filter is clogged or there is low fuel pressure due to contaminants in the system, it can cause sputtering during acceleration. Regular maintenance and replacing the filter can ensure that your fuel system is clear and functioning as it should.

Spark Plugs and Ignition System

Worn or damaged spark plugs might be causing your engine to misfire, hesitate, or even stall. Spark plugs are responsible for igniting the fuel in the engine, and if they aren’t working correctly, it can disrupt the combustion process. Over time, worn-out spark plugs struggle to create the proper spark, leading to sputtering. Replacing the plugs can help restore steady combustion and smooth out your engine’s performance.

Mass Airflow Sensor Problems

The mass airflow sensor measures how much air enters the engine, and if it’s malfunctioning, it won’t provide accurate information to your car’s computer. This leads to incorrect air-fuel mixing, which can cause the engine to sputter or even stall. If your vehicle is hesitating during acceleration, it might be time to clean or replace this critical sensor to avoid further performance issues.

Leaky Vacuum Hoses

Vacuum leaks are another common problem that can affect your engine’s performance. If the vacuum hoses are damaged or develop cracks, they can cause disruptions in airflow and pressure. This will lead to engine hesitation, stalling, or a loss of power when accelerating. Checking these hoses for wear and tear and replacing them promptly can prevent further problems and ensure smoother driving.

Transmission and Cooling System Failures

While the engine components are often the main focus, transmission issues can also cause hesitation or sputtering. If the transmission isn’t transferring power effectively, you may notice that the car hesitates or sputters when you accelerate. Additionally, a cooling system that isn’t functioning properly can lead to engine overheating, which can further worsen the sputtering problem.

Electrical System or Battery Issues

Lastly, issues with the electrical system or weak wiring continuity in the harness can cause sputtering by preventing the engine from receiving adequate power. If your car sputters more when accelerating uphill or under a heavier load, it could be a sign that the battery or alternator is failing to supply enough power. Ensuring that your electrical components are in good shape can help solve this problem.
